Hi, is it possible to give or request control when screen sharing using any combination of browsers and app? This would be for external users, re: external customer screen sharing and giving control to me. The external customer would not have a Teams account or office 365.

Screen sharing using chrome external customer to me is confirmed working. I believe an admin could enable the right policy so the external customer would have the give / request control buttons but I am not 100% on that. Please let me know.

@aeb5005 we've updated our documentation to note the limitation around giving/taking control when participants are on Teams in the browser. See the note at the bottom of this section:
https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/microsoftteams/limits-specifications-teams#browsers

1 To give and take control of shared content during sharing, both parties must be using the Teams desktop client. Control isn't supported when either party is running Teams in a browser. This is due to a technical limitation that we're planning to fix. To learn more, read Allow a participant to give or request control.
